Everyone is talking about the Google dance but only few words are directed towards a much more important date: the date when the deepbot will crawl the sites to build next months index.

What are your experiences about the Googlebot cycle? How many days after the Google dance will the deepbot come to your site and index it?

The reason for this question is pretty easy: we've got quite a big project ready to start and want to appear at Google from the very beginning. The domain was already built up with good pagerank during the last months and we'd need ~ 2 weeks to get all the content ready in a _perfect_ style but we can and will put it online right now if there's a chance to get it into the next Google index.

Any help would be greatly appreciated. And yes - I've read the googlebot FAQ [webmasterworld.com] but it is pretty vague about the number of days after the dance...

Its very vague because there is no hard and fast rule. I would say as a rough guide - about a week after the dance finalises (ie New results have shown up in www).
If you watch your server logs, you will see googlebot come with an ip address starting with 2 (instead of 6 which is mr Freshie). This will tell you that the deep crawl has started.
